A morphing segmented concept is proposed herein for future extreme-scale wind turbine systems. The morphing may be accomplished by using segmented blades connected by screw sockets and a tension cable system. Combined Cycle Gas Turbine (CCGT) integrates two cyclesBrayton cycle (Gas Turbine) and Rankine cycle (Steam Turbine) with the objective of increasing overall plant efficiency. In modern gas turbine the temperature of the exhaust gases is in the range of 500 oC to 550 oC. Modern steam power plants have steam temperature in the range of 500 oC to 630 oC.
